There's a potentially unique Movado M90 coming up for auction on Nov 10 and would like to get some thoughts as to the originality of the dial and hands. Movado had a lot of unique designs which makes it difficult to pin down a true original watch.
A couple things:
Dial: Logo seems correct but I've never seen green lettering.
Second hand: White squared seconds hand. I've only seen this on sports watches from the 70s and this one is from the 50s.
Running seconds and minute counter hand: Both look to have been trimmed. Possibly trimmed to fit a different watch and then brought to this one?
After typing this out I think I know the conclusion but any input on this or just the Movado market, in general, would be great.
